2.3. Internal DC switch
Please verify whether your Autarco SX-series inverter is equipped with an internal DC switch. This switch can be
found on the bottom of the inverter (see 3.4). If there isn’t an internal DC switch it is important to apply an
external DC disconnector in order to completely disconnect the solar PV module strings from the inverter.

4.2. Mounting instructions
The inverter is suitable for outdoor and indoor installation Vertical installation is recommended, with a maximum inclination of 15 backwards Make sure the mounting wall is strong enough to hold the weight of the inverter The ambient temperature of installation site should be between -20 C and +60 C It is not recommended that the inverter is exposed to the direct sunshine Make sure of ample ventilation at installation site, insufficient ventilation may reduce the performance of
the electronic components inside the inverter and shorten the life span of the inverter
DANGER
DO NOT install the inverter near flammable or explosive items. This inverter will be connected to a high voltage DC power generator and AC grid. The
installation must be performed by qualified personnel and in compliance with national and local standards and regulations.
NOTICE
Inappropriate installation may jeopardize the life span of the inverter.
Directly exposure to intense sunshine is not recommended. The installation site MUST have good ventilation conditions.

5. Electrical installation
5.1. AC connection
The Autarco inverter is equipped with an integrated Residual Current Protective Device (RCPD) and Residual Current Operated Monitor (RCOM). The RCOM will detect the volume of the leakage current and compare it with the expected value, if the leakage current exceeds the permitted range, the RCPD will disconnect the inverter from the AC load.
If regulations in the country of installation stipulate an external residual current device, you must use a device with a tripping threshold of 100 mA or more.
The AC cable used must be dimensioned in accordance with any local and national directives on cable dimensions which specify requirements for the minimum conductor cross-section. Cable dimensioning factors are e.g.: nominal AC current, type of cable, type of routing, cable bundling, ambient temperature and maximum specified line losses.
We recommend 4mm 105 cable with resistance lower than 1.5 ohm.

Step 2: Strip outer jacket 60mm and strip each cable insolation about 12±1mm
Step 3: Insert cable strands into connector socket, and lock the screws.
Make sure to fit the ground wire into the PE hole.
Step 4: Fit the adapter, cable gland body and cable glad cap to the connector as per below
11
Always use separate fuses for consumer load. Use dedicated circuit breakers with load switch functionality for load switching.
The selection of the mains circuit breaker rating depends on the wiring design (wire cross- section area), cable type, wiring method, ambient temperature, inverter current rating etc. Derating of the circuit breaker rating may be necessary due to self-heating or if exposed to heat.

6. Operation
6.1. LED indicator lights
There are three LED status indicator lights in the front panel of SX series inverters. The left POWER light (red) indicates power status of the inverter. The middle OPERATION light (green) indicates the operation status. The right ALARM light (yellow) indicates the alarm status. Table 3.1 explains their meanings.
Light
Status
Description
POWER
ON
The PV array provides power to the inverter
OFF
The PV array does not provide power to the inverter
OPERATION
ON
The inverter is feeding AC power to the grid
OFF
The inverter is not feeding AC power to the grid
FLASHING
The inverter is initializing
ALARM
ON
There is an fault, refer to the inverter display and chapter 11 of this manual for details
OFF
The inverter is operation normally
When inverter DC switch and AC switch have been turned on the inverter will start initializing. After approx. 3 minutes the inverter will start normal operation with the inverter display showing GENERATING.
6.2. Inverter display
The display content consists of 2 lines. During regular operation the display shows the current power and operation status alternatively for 10 seconds. Pressing the UP or DOWN buttons will manually cycle through these two displays. Pressing the ENTER button gives access to the main menu which has four sub menus:
Information, described in detail in chapter 6.3. Settings, described in detail in chapter 6.4. Advanced information, described in detail in chapter 6.5. Advanced settings, described in details in chapter 6.6.
By pressing UP or DOWN keys you can cycle through these sub menus and click ENTER to go into the submenu.

8. Maintenance
The SX-series inverters do not require regular maintenance. However, impurities such as dust and dirt accumulation
on the heat sink may negatively affect the inverter’s ability to dissipate heat. Any dirt or dust can be removed
with a cloth or soft brunch.
9. Disposal
To comply with European Directive 2002/96/EC on waste Electrical and Electronic Equipment and its implementation as national law, electrical equipment that has reached the end of its life must be collected separately and returned to an approved recycling facility. Ignoring this EU Directive may have severe effects on the environment and your health.

11.2. Grid errors
Error type
Display message
Error code
Error description
Action
Over voltage
OV-G-V
1010
Grid voltage exceeds the standard set in the inverter
1. Wait to see if the grid voltage returns within limits.
2. If problem persists, check whether the grid standard is set
correctly in Advanced Settings (see 6.6).
3. Check V_AC, grid voltage, in Information display of inverter
(see 0) and perform independent measurement of grid voltage to confirm that the inverter reading is correct. If the measured voltage is outside the local grid standard limits, please contact your local utility as it may require monitoring and adjustment
4. With agreement from utility it is possible to set a user
defined voltage range (see 6.6).
